To glaze, or not to glaze

Being a bit of a klutz, I never get through a framing session without spilling red stuff on mat board.  So, for shows in my gallery and the PhotoZone gallery, I choose to frame without glass.  If I am showing in a more formal gallery, then I give in to the norm.  But everyone I talk to agrees that images look much better without the added reflections.

Certainly, glass protects the image, but in my case it doesn’t matter too much since I print my own work.  Cost isn’t the issue if an image shines with a more intimate vibrance.
